2nd is my Roomba, this is the coolest thing
to come along in a long time. A Robot that actually has a purpose.
Not just to run around and be cute. This little guy can vacuum my
whole living room in about 15-20 minutes. It's really amazing! 3
hours to charge the battery, set it in the middle of the room, push
a button and walk away. It comes with these little units that shoot
out an infrared beam that act as an ivisible wall. Put them down and
aim them across a room or doorway and the Roomba will stay in the
defined area. It won't fall down the stairs and even executes escape
maneuvers if it gets kinda stuck. It's just downright
amazing!
And it works! Not just kinda works, it WORKS! Cat hair,
cat litter, Christmas Tree pine needles, dirt and dust I didn't even
know was there. With it's side beater brush it gets the dirt
out of of the edges of the room better than our upright vacuum.
There is a mode for cleaning just a small area and it even knows
when it has found a real dirty area and it will stop and super clean
that area.
